import os
from gettext import gettext as _
import gconf
_zone_tab = '/usr/share/zoneinfo/zone.tab'
def _initialize():
"""Initialize the docstring of the set function"""
if set_timezone.__doc__ is None:
# when running under 'python -OO', all __doc__ fields are None,
# so += would fail -- and this function would be unnecessary anyway.
return
timezones = read_all_timezones()
for timezone in timezones:
set_timezone.__doc__ += timezone + '\n'
def read_all_timezones(fn=_zone_tab):
fd = open(fn, 'r')
lines = fd.readlines()
fd.close()
timezones = []
for line in lines:
if line.startswith('#'):
continue
line = line.split()
if len(line) > 1:
timezones.append(line[2])
timezones.sort()
for offset in xrange(-12, 13):
if offset < 0:
tz = 'GMT%d' % offset
elif offset > 0:
tz = 'GMT+%d' % offset
else:
tz = 'GMT'
timezones.append(tz)
for offset in xrange(-12, 13):
if offset < 0:
tz = 'UTC%d' % offset
elif offset > 0:
tz = 'UTC+%d' % offset
else:
tz = 'UTC'
timezones.append(tz)
return timezones
def get_timezone():
client = gconf.client_get_default()
return client.get_string('/desktop/sugar/date/timezone')
def print_timezone():
print get_timezone()
def set_timezone(timezone):
"""Set the system timezone
timezone : e.g. 'America/Los_Angeles'
"""
timezones = read_all_timezones()
if timezone in timezones:
os.environ['TZ'] = timezone
client = gconf.client_get_default()
client.set_string('/desktop/sugar/date/timezone', timezone)
else:
raise ValueError(_('Error timezone does not exist.'))
return 1
# inilialize the docstrings for the timezone
_initialize()
